There are many free resources available online to learn digital marketing at home like pdfs, blogs, articles, video tutorials and so on. I would suggest you to go with the one that provides better information of topics. For that I would like you to watch this video below-
This video has covered all the required concepts of digital marketing upon watching this video you will have better understanding about digital marketing.